Sammy Ledbetter, Webb (TN), 2026 Positional Profile: 2B/RHP Body: 5-11, 187-pounds. Moved well with early signs of athleticism Hit: RHH. Narrow open stance, Hands start in a lower position with a bigger leg lift Swings hard with a lot of forward momentum, Showed good exit velo potential 69.7 mph bat speed with 12 G's of rotational acceleration. Power: 98 max exit velocity, averaged 88.9 mph. 328' max distance. Arm: RH. INF-84 mph. Short arm action and throws from a 3/4 arm slot Defense: Showed patience on the ball and trusted his arm ATH: 7.58 runner in the 60. 1.83 and 4.18 in the 10 and 30 yard splits. 18.10 max vertical. Vizual Edge: 77.26 Edge Score

Sammy Ledbetter, Webb (TN), 2026 Positional Profile: 2B/RHP Body: 5-11, 187-pounds. Moved well with early signs of athleticism Delivery: Slow moving delivery and uses his backside well. Arm Action: RH. Clean arm action and hides the ball well on his backside. FB: T85, 83-85 mph. Really high IVB and carry to his FB T2036, 1928 average rpm. CB: 70-72 mph. CB was commanded at the bottom of the zone that tunnels well with his FB T2078, 2045 average rpm. CH: 73-77 mph. CH was in the zone and looked like his FB T1924, 1494 average rpm. ATH: 7.58 runner in the 60. 1.83 and 4.18 in the 10 and 30 yard splits. 18.10 max vertical.
